Step 01 · 1-2 weeks
Validate the problem
Run 10 customer interviews with teams that churn. Ask why they left competitors, what would've kept them, and how they measure success today.
Step 02 · 4-8 weeks
Build a focused MVP
Build a minimum viable retention tool—maybe a churn predictor, automated win-back email or usage insight. Nothing fancy; prove the idea in 4-6 weeks.
Step 03 · 1 week
Prepare your launch
Craft positioning around retention ROI. Create 3 landing page variants. Write a case study template. Record a 60-second demo video.
Step 04 · Launch day
Launch across directories
List on LaunchTry, Product Hunt and niche communities (SaaS Founders, r/saas). Get early signal on market demand.
Step 05 · Ongoing
Grow and iterate
Talk to your first 20 customers every week. Measure activation rates, weekly retention and referral momentum. Iterate ruthlessly on messaging and feature priorities.
